The postcode S41 9BS is located in Chesterfield, in the county of Derbysh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and terminated in May 2002.S41 9BS is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
S41 9BS is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of S41 9BS as Rural residents > Ageing rural dwellers > Renting rural retirement.
The closest road name to S41 9BS is Sheepbridge Lane which is centered 163 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Endeavour Training and is 181 m away. The closest railway station is Chesterfield Rail Station, 3.72 km away.
The closest primary school to S41 9BS (for ages 11 and under) is Mary Swanwick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 20, 2021.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Outwood Academy Newbold. The last OFSTED inspection on November 15,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of S41 9BS is Robin Hood Inn and is 10.07 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 2, 2021.
Policing for S41 9BS is covered by the Derbyshire police force association and Derbyshire County is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
